BlackBerry Storm 3This isn’t confirmed by any means, but if true, what we have here today is RIM’s next full touchscreen phone, the BlackBerry Storm 3. Sent to BerryReview by an anonymous tipster, this alleged Storm 3 boasts of a 3.7-inch touchscreen, 8GB of memory, and comes with mobile WiFi hotspot capabilities. We can also tell based on the picture that, unlike its two predecessors, this one features an optical trackpad for navigation located just below its touchscreen display. We're gong out on a limb and guessing that this baby will also come preloaded with BlackBerry 6 as its OS. According to BGR, this is not the Storm 3 as they’ve reportedly seen the actual device already, but later on updated their post after getting a tip that what they saw was actually just a refreshed Storm 2.

We honestly don’t know what to believe at this point in time, but one thing's pretty clear in our minds, RIM’s got a new touchscreen phone in the pipeline.
